Summary:

It is a lens which can be used wide open with confidence.

Strengths:

Sharp wide open. Good colour. Good size & weight without the hood.

Weaknesses:

A little expensive for what it is. The hood is heavy and oversize. 77mm filter thread.

Customer Service:

I had gone through 3 faulty samples before I got a perfect one. Pentax needed to improve their QC.

Summary:

It gives very good optical performance even shooting in a dim day. Very solid and weight feeling. If you can't afford almost 1.6kg weight of FA 80-200/2.8 lens, you should go for this lens which should not make you disappointed. AF speed is reasonable for most purpose (used with MZ 5n), but I think not too good enough for sports shots.

Strengths:

Good optics whatever in colour reproduction and sharpness.
Reasonable packing size and convenient for travelling

Weaknesses:

A bit expensive than similar class products and no AF built in motor available.

Similar Products Used:

Nikon AIS 180mm F2.8, some 80-200/2.8 lens of Tokina, Pentax, Nikon, etc.

Summary:

Very sharp, even at 2.8! Gorgeous build quality / finish. Focus down to 1.2 m. Very easy selector MF/AF. Still very good with Sigma Apo-Extender 2x.
Price a little bit high: the 180/2.8 Nikon and the 200/2.8 Canon are cheeper. But are they as good ?
I LOVE THIS LENSE.

Strengths:

Everything

Weaknesses:

Price

Similar Products Used:

Tamron SP180/2.5, Leitz R-180/2.8, Leitz R-180/3.4 Apo, Tamron MF 200/3.5.

Summary:

Great lens. worth every penny paid for it (retails for $1000 to $1100). Too bad Pentax does not make matching teleconverters for it, but I do use both Tamron's 1.4 and 2x AF with good results.

Strengths:

Well balanced, great optics, tack sharp, fast focuser, excellent flare control.

Weaknesses:

None so far. The silvery paint makes me nervous about scratching its nice finish.

Similar Products Used:

Only zooms up to 200 mm but none comparable
